Energy Transition Task Force

MAIN OBJECTIVES

  • To plan, recommend, create, evaluate and promote initiatives focusing on achieving net-zero emissions by mid-century. 
  • Sharing the best practices in innovation and promoting new solutions to meet sustainability and efficiency. 
  • Initiate and organize events. 
  • To enhance private-public sector cooperation between local and international entities to facilitate energy transition. 
  • To offer a platform for an innovative energy transition ideas. 
  • To train and educate the younger generation on the importance of using clean energy.

EOG Committee was launched in 2012 to unify the industry’s voice and to work in parallel with the government to enhance the well-being of the petroleum industry. Egypt Oil & Gas Committee brings together exploration and production companies, service companies, government entities, and leading industry experts under one roof to address the challenges the industry is facing, and to find potential solutions.
